Understanding Net Worth and Public Disclosure
Before diving into specific figures, it's essential to understand what constitutes net worth. Simply put, net worth is the difference between an individual's assets (what they own) and their liabilities (what they owe). For public officials like Senator Rubio, certain financial disclosures are mandated by law, providing a glimpse into their financial affairs. These disclosures typically include:
- Assets: Real estate, stocks, bonds, retirement accounts, and other investments.
- Liabilities: Mortgages, loans, and other debts.
- Income: Salary, speaking fees, book royalties, and other sources of revenue.

1. What is the most reliable source for determining Marco Rubio's net worth?
OpenSecrets.org is a reputable source that analyzes financial disclosure reports of members of Congress. However, it's important to remember that their figures are estimates based on reported ranges, not precise values.
2. Are politicians required to disclose all their assets?
No. While they are required to disclose certain assets, such as real estate, stocks, and bonds, there may be assets that are not required to be disclosed, or are held in a way that makes them difficult to trace.
3. How can book royalties impact a politician's net worth?
Book royalties can significantly contribute to a politician's income and overall assets, especially if they are successful authors. However, royalty income can fluctuate depending on book sales.
4. What is the significance of a politician's financial disclosure reports?
Financial disclosure reports provide transparency into a politician's financial affairs, allowing the public to assess potential conflicts of interest and understand their financial standing.
5. Why do net worth estimates for politicians vary so much?
Net worth estimates can vary due to different methodologies, assumptions about asset valuation, and the use of range-based data in financial disclosure reports. It's important to consider the source and methodology when evaluating these estimates.
